I have a laptop but no sata , you say I can use a usb to sata cable to flash the firmware . I have looked for the step by step instruction using this method but no luck . A long tutorial I read says this isnt poss as usb doesnt work under dos . Im sure you can tell this is my first time but would value any help or direction , have looked at pretty much evrey forum . Its impossible at the moment to flash a samsung via a usb adapter because DOS doesnt have the drivers for one. A Hitachi however can be done with an adapter because you flash it (garyopa) in windows from running the cmd. _________________________________________________________
